Household employers in Ohio are required to get coverage for workers’ compensation insurance. These policies pay for medical expenses and lost wages if an employee has a work-related injury or illness. To acquire a workers’ compensation policy, please contact the Ohio Bureau of Workers’ Compensation at (800) 644-6292. Infant care programs provide r...5. Withhold Social Security and Medicare taxes from your nanny’s pay each pay period. These taxes are collectively known as FICA and must be withheld from your nanny’s pay. Social Security taxes will be 6.2 percent of your nanny’s gross (before taxes) wages and Medicare taxes will be 1.45 percent of their gross wages.Happiness guarantee: If HomePay doesn't meet your expectations for an all-in-one nanny tax and payroll service during your first six months of use, we'll refund your payments for our services.** ... When you hire a senior caregiver, there are many details to go over, things to discuss with your family and ultimately agree on the best strategy for how care should be ...Federal wage and hour law states that household employees do not have to be paid for up to 8 hours of sleeping time when they work 24 consecutive hours or more. Note: Employers in California are unable to take this sleep time exemption. Household employers in Pennsylvania are required to provide their employees with a written wage notice at the time of hire. The notice must include the employer’s address and the employee’s hourly rate of pay.
